Looking at what you have to repair on the lower section of the green cowl, you likely could form that area by clamping some sheet metal in a vise and tap over the folds using a nice flat body hammer. Then to add the shrinking for the "roll under", I would use some heat and quenching. The flat part in the middle we would want to leave alone, no shrinking. Then, by shrinking the sides in a wide vee, and the flanges in a rectangular to match the wide vee's lower dimension, we should be able to water cool and provide shrink. See link:

Although not visible, you would want to heat both sides and flanges at the same time for better rolling action. Trying to heat only one side will leave the other trying to keep everything straight. You don't need it bright cherry red, as this will tend to cause more scale to form, but try to get both sides heated directly across from each other before quenching, for best results. Leave some excess on the ends in order to trim later, trying to radius right at the end doesn't give you much to work with, especially if you need to resort to plan B, which is heating, stick one end in vise to clamp, LIGHTLY pull toward the shrink direction, then quench. If you pull too much, it will kink. But heat the two sides and flanges, quench, then check to the truck for fitment. Move as needed for the next shrink spot, whether that is 1/4" , 1/2", etc. The wide vee and rectangular spots will likely (and should) overlap before all is said and done in order to get enough shrink in there to form the radius you need.
